ABSTRACT:
In these modern days, electric vehicles are well known for its efficiency, it would be a cost saving choice
compared to the ICE car, due to its advantages such as silent engine, zero emission which are totally
green to the environment. However the selection of a suitable battery type such as lead acid, NiMH,
Lithium ion in the long run plays a very important role in the construction or design of the electric vehicle
due to its function and also the physical aspects. In terms of the functionality, the vehicle must be able to
provide sufficient energy to allow the car to move or accelerate
and at the same time, having a long
lifespan or constant power supplied to the vehicle. Taking this into consideration, lithium ion battery have
been selected as the main power source when designing an electric car, this can be viewed from the
characteristics of a lithium ion battery such as fast charging rate, light weight, high capacity and long
charge-discharge cycle, etc. Hence the design of battery pack using lithium ion battery inclusive of its
compartment design, ventilation and the monitoring system will be discussed in this paper.
